French Kitchen Heritage
In France, the torchon is far more than a simple kitchen towel - it's an essential element of daily life and a symbol of French domestic artistry. These sturdy linen towels were crafted to withstand daily use while maintaining their beauty, embodying the French philosophy that functional items should also bring joy and elegance to everyday tasks.

Care & Preservation
Traditional French linen care:
Machine wash in hot water for authentic French treatment
Line dry in sunlight when possible (natural bleaching and freshening)
Iron while slightly damp for best results
The beauty of French linens is that they improve with use and proper care
